The Southern Highlands is an exciting and relaxing destination rich in tradition and history. The author of Mary Poppins created some of her inspiring tales in the Highlands and the Bradman Museum in Bowral honours Australia's greatest cricketer. There are many attractions from the quaint villages and cafes, gourmet delights to be enjoyed on a food and wine trail, "Tulip time" during the "open gardens" festival and the Bong Bong picnic race meeting. You can ride bikes on many tracks including the Wingecarribee river path where the explosion of Autumn colours, Winter mists and snow provide a healthy activity and wonderful vistas. There are waterfalls, national parks, 17 wineries, boutiques, stately mansions, the oldest polo cross club in the world and it is one of regional Australia's most expensive suburbs.
